- The distance between Bear Island/ Bjørnøya, Svalbard, Norway and Vagamo, Oppland, Norway is approximately 1,462 km or 909 mi.
- To reach Bear Island/ Bjørnøya, Svalbard in this distance one would set out from Vagamo, Oppland bearing 11.8°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Bear Island/ Bjørnøya, Svalbard bearing 21.2° or NNE .
- Bear Island/ Bjørnøya, Svalbard has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Vagamo, Oppland has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- The average temperature is 4.2 °C (7.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.5 °C (22.5°F) less in Bear Island/ Bjørnøya, Svalbard.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 67 mm (2.6 in) more which is equivalent to 67 l/m² (1.64 US gal/ft²) or 670,000 l/ha (71,627 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.6° lower in Bear Island/ Bjørnøya, Svalbard than in Vagamo, Oppland.
- Relative humidity levels are 12.8%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 1.9°C (3.4°F) lower.
